SEC Gives Whistle-Blower $110 Million in Payout

Article (Bloomberg) — The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ission awarded $110 million to a tipster whose information resulted in enforcement actions, bringing total payments under the agency’s whistle-blower program to more than $1 billion. The tipster’s award, the second-largest ever, includes $40 million from the SEC and $70 million from a related action brought by … Read more

Obama meddles in Canadian election…

TORONTO — Barack Obama endorsed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au on Thursday in the Canadian election, calling him an effective leader in a rare endorsement of a candidate in a Canadian election by a former American president. It is the second time Obama has done it. Obama also urged Canadians to re-elect the Liberal leader in … Read more
